Хочу заюзать ф-цию encode из модуля Data.Binary: ---------------------------------------- import Data.Binary main = do s1 <- encode (2 :: Integer) print s1 ---------------------------------------- encode :: Binary a => a -> ByteString Экземпляр Binary Integer есть. $ ghc --make Test.hs -o test [1 of 1] Compiling Main ( Test.hs, Test.o ) Test.hs:3:16: Couldn't match expected type `t t1' against inferred type `Data.ByteString.Lazy.Internal.ByteString' In a 'do' expression: s1 <- encode 'a' In the expression: do s1 <- encode 'a' print s1 In the definition of `main': main = do s1 <- encode 'a' print s1 Подрубаю модуль import Data.ByteString.Lazy.Internal (ByteString) Ошибка: Test.hs:3:16: Couldn't match expected type `t t1' against inferred type `ByteString' ....... далее тож самое Почему не хочет работать ?
Ответ на:
комментарий
от Miguel
Ответ на:
комментарий
от brahman
Ответ на:
комментарий
от brahman
Ответ на:
комментарий
от brahman
Ответ на:
комментарий
от Miguel
Ответ на:
комментарий
от brahman
Ответ на:
комментарий
от brahman
Ответ на:
комментарий
от brahman
Ответ на:
комментарий
от Miguel
Ответ на:
комментарий
от Miguel
Ответ на:
комментарий
от brahman
Ответ на:
комментарий
от brahman
Ответ на:
комментарий
от Miguel
Ответ на:
комментарий
от brahman
Ответ на:
комментарий
от brahman
Ответ на:
комментарий
от brahman
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.
Похожие темы
- Форум [Haskell] Нормальная ли структура программы? (2010)
- Форум [haskell][cabal] Не канпеляется haddock (2011)
- Форум xmonad.hs, плавающие окна, как? (2011)
- Форум Стали доступны исходные коды Idris 2 (2019)
- Форум Сравнение производительности доступа к полям структур в Python, Common Lisp и С++ (2017)
- Форум не получается установить скомпилированный gnash installer (2016)
- Форум Lisp & C ф-ции (2007)
- Форум Нужна помощь,ф-ция condvar() (2010)
- Форум Вопрос по чистоте ф-ций (2015)
- Форум Определения ф-ций в С (2011)